Yeast Strain Reference

Yeast choice moves a beer's final gravity, its clarity, its fermentation temperature comfort zone, and — for a lot of styles — most of the flavour, more than any other single ingredient decision. Two brewers can mash the same grain bill, boil the same hops, and end up with meaningfully different beers purely because of which strain they pitched and at what temperature they let it work.

Every strain page here states the manufacturer's own published typical attenuation range (how much of the wort's fermentable extract that strain tends to convert), its recommended fermentation temperature range, and its flocculation — how readily it clumps and drops out of suspension once fermentation slows, which drives both how fast a beer clears and how much residual yeast character stays in suspension. These are the numbers printed on the packet or the manufacturer's product data sheet; real results in your own fermenter will still move around with pitch rate, aeration, wort composition and how tightly you hold the target temperature, which is why the range exists in the first place rather than a single number.

The roster spans the labs homebrewers actually buy from — Fermentis's dry packets (US-05, S-04, W-34/70 and the rest of the Safale/Saflager lines), Lallemand's dry strains including the increasingly popular kveik lines that ferment cleanly at unusually high temperatures, and the major liquid yeast producers, White Labs and Wyeast, whose catalogues cover everything from clean American ale strains to the full range of Belgian, German lager, and wild/farmhouse cultures. Cider and mead brewers get their own entries too — wine yeasts like EC-1118, 71B, D47 and K1-V1116 behave nothing like beer yeast, and treating a cider must like a beer wort when choosing a strain is a common and avoidable mistake.

Use the "best for" field on each strain page as a starting filter, then cross-check the attenuation range against the style guideline page for whatever you're brewing — a strain that tops out at 72% attenuation will never hit the dry finish a style guideline calls for no matter how long you leave it in the fermenter.
